去除静态文本框的背景色和设置颜色
2013-03-19 11:57
120 查看
//缺省的静态文本框有一个灰色的背景色,确实很讨厌,字体颜色也很单调,不过我们可以设置
case WM_CTLCOLORSTATIC://设置静态文本框字体颜色
{
if (GetDlgItem(hwnd, 1) == (HWND)lParam)//这里的1是静态文本框的ID
{
SetTextColor((HDC)wParam, RGB(255,0,255));
SetBkMode((HDC)wParam, TRANSPARENT);
//return (LRESULT)CreateSolidBrush(GetSysColor(COLOR_BTNFACE));
return (BOOL)((HBRUSH)GetStockObject(NULL_BRUSH));
}
break;
}
case WM_CTLCOLORSTATIC://设置静态文本框字体颜色
{
if (GetDlgItem(hwnd, 1) == (HWND)lParam)//这里的1是静态文本框的ID
{
SetTextColor((HDC)wParam, RGB(255,0,255));
SetBkMode((HDC)wParam, TRANSPARENT);
//return (LRESULT)CreateSolidBrush(GetSysColor(COLOR_BTNFACE));
return (BOOL)((HBRUSH)GetStockObject(NULL_BRUSH));
}
break;
}
相关文章推荐
- 永久设置SecureCRT的背景色和文字颜色方案
- markdown编辑器语法——文字颜色、大小、字体与背景色的设置(转)
- ListView中设置item的背景色后,默认的行点击颜色失效的解决办法
- 解决 设置导航栏背景色 和影响状态栏的颜色 问题
- extjs grid设置某行字体颜色及背景色
- swift开发笔记1-设置顶部导航条背景色和字体颜色
- ios导航栏字体颜色及背景色设置rgb
- [置顶] csdn-markdown字体颜色和背景色设置
- JTextPane例子,演示为文字设置字体、字号、样式、颜色、背景色和插入图片功能
- markdown编辑器语法——文字颜色、大小、字体与背景色的设置(转)
- android:为TextView添加样式——下划线,颜色,设置链接样式及前背景色
- UITableViewCell背景色.选中背景色,分割线,字体颜色设置
- Android button设置背景色与边框颜色
- 设置对话框、static和group的背景色和字体颜色
- POI 设置单元格背景色,背景色编码与实际颜色对照表
- SecureCRT中设置背景色和文字颜色
- Extjs grid设置单元格字体颜色,及单元格背景色
- JTextPane例子,演示为文字设置字体、字号、样式、颜色、背景色和插入图片功能
- JTextPane例子,演示为文字设置字体、字号、样式、颜色、背景色和插入图片功能